About AdAction

Founded in 2013, AdAction is a leader in performance-based mobile app marketing, helping the world’s top brands acquire premium users at scale. We partner globally to deliver strategic, data-driven solutions that drive measurable growth.

Our team th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ment built on autonomy, accountability, and innovation. We value people who take initiative, think strategically, and want to make a meaningful impact—not just within their role, but across the business.

As a remote-first company with talent hubs in Denver, Austin, and Chicago, we prioritize flexibility while creating intentional opportunities for connection through regular in-person events, team gatherings, and company retreats.


About The Role

AdAction is looking for an HR Manager to lead our People function across a growing, distributed team.

This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a high-growth environment and enjoys balancing strategic HR initiatives with day-to-day execution. You’ll own the full employee lifecycle—from onboarding and employee experience to performance management, compliance, and offboarding—while also driving culture-building programs, employee engagement, and company events.

This is a highly visible role for someone who is proactive, organized, people-first, and excited to make an impact.


ResponsibilitiesPeople Operations & Employee Experience
  • Own and manage the full employee lifecycle, including onboarding, compensation updates, promotions, and offboarding

  • Continuously improve onboarding processes to create a seamless and engaging new hire experience

  • Conduct exit interviews and identify trends and opportunities for improvement

  • Track annual performance review cycles and support managers through the process

  • Maintain employee records, HR systems, and organizational reporting with accuracy and confidentiality

  • Support compliance initiatives including required trainings, policy updates, and documentation

  • Administer day-to-day HR operations across systems including ADP, GSuite, Slack, and related tools

  • Partner with leadership on employee relations, engagement, and people strategy initiatives

Culture, Engagement & Internal Programs
  • Lead employee engagement initiatives, surveys, and recognition programs

  • Plan and execute company social events, happy hours, and team-building experiences across all locations

  • Own logistics and execution for company retreats and in-person gatherings

  • Coordinate conference prep, company swag, gifting, and partner experiences

  • Manage Uber accounts, reporting, and event transportation logistics

  • Help foster and strengthen AdAction’s culture across a remote-first environment

Experience & Qualifications
  • 2-3 years of experience in HR, People Operations, or a related People & Culture role

  • Strong understanding of employee lifecycle management and HR best practices

  • Exceptional organization and project management skills with strong attention to detail

  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and operate independently in a fast-paced environment

  • Excellent communication skills and strong emotional intelligence

  • High level of discretion and professionalism when handling confidential information

  • Experience with HRIS platforms such as ADP or similar systems

  • Experience planning internal events, retreats, or employee engagement programs is a strong plus

  • A proactive mindset and genuine passion for building strong teams and workplace culture

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
